Most professional race series depend on a grassroots effort to find their future.  Formula Drift is no different, and Sonoma Drift at Race Sonoma here in Northern California, has a solid group of talented drivers working hard toward getting their FD licenses.

This is my second year covering the event and like the title says: It just keeps getting better.  The show is awesome and very well-run from start to finish.  The organizers and participants alike, understand exactly what it takes to put on a great day of competition and provide a very fun atmosphere.

If you enjoy seeing future stars before they get famous in the “big leagues” of drifting, then you definitely need to make your way out to a Sonoma Drift event.
